Tiny PC Aiming For Console Performance
- Valve built a compact living-room PC about the size of a Kleenex box that targets TV gaming performance.
- Sean Hollister says it delivers roughly PS5 Pro-class performance by upscaling 1080p to 4K for good living-room visuals.
Compact Design Trades Upgradability For Integration
- The Steam Machine sacrifices PC upgradability: CPU and GPU are soldered but SSD and memory can be expanded.
- Sean notes the design packs power, RF shielding, and a large cooling stack into a much smaller footprint than equivalent PCs.
Use The Controller Puck For Easy Multiplayer
- Use the included puck to pair and charge controllers and add up to four controllers per puck for couch multiplayer.
- Place the second puck near the couch for convenient charging and instant pairing.
